1986 was the year that Halley's Comet was seen, write a function to represent a linear function for Halley's Comet for the next

5 times the comet will be seen.
Will giveaway alot of points. Need it asap.
Mathematics
1 answer:
ch4aika [34]3 years ago
6 0

Answer: y(k) = 75.32*k + 1986

Steps:

Orbital period ‎of the Halley's comet is 75.32 years. Set up a function with variable k denoting the "k-th" time the comet is seen again since last sighting in 1986:

y(k) = 75.32*k + 1986

The function value is the year (including decimal fraction) when the comet will be seen for the k-the time since 1986.

What is the Rate of Change?

A rate of change defines how one quantity changes in relation to another quantity. The rate of change can be either positive or negative. Since the slope of a line is the ratio of vertical and horizontal change between two points on the plane or a line, then the slope equals the ratio of the rise and the run.

Where, rise is the vertical change between two points and run is the horizontal change between two points.

Standard Formula

The standard form for the rate of change of slope, m is given by

Rate of change = Rise/ Run

= Δy / Δx

Therefore, the rate of change of slope =(y2 – y1) / (x2 – x1)

Where

Δ represents the rate of change

(x1, x2) is the X coordinates

(y1, y2) is the Y coordinates

What is meant by slope?

The slope represents the gradient of the line. It is denoted by the symbol “m”. It defines the rate of change.

Can a slope be negative?

A slope can be either positive or negative. If a line has a positive slope (i.e., m > 0), then y always increases when x increases and y always decreases when x decreases. Also, if a line has a negative slope (i.e., m<0), then y always increases when x decreases and y always decreases when x increases.

What is the formula for the slope?

The formula to find the slope is

m = (y2 – y1) / (x2 – x1)

Where

(x1, x2) is the X coordinates

(y1, y2) is the Y coordinates
